Patent number: 11816216Abstract: An example embodiment of the present techniques determines, in response to a byte-serving request to download a portion of a resource, that the resource has previously been determined to comprise malware. Further, the byte-serving request is modified to request downloading all the resource. Additionally, all the resource is requested for downloading using the modified byte-serving request.Type: GrantFiled: January 27, 2016Date of Patent: November 14, 2023Assignee: Hewlett Packard Enterprise Development LPInventor: Ramesh Ardeli

Publication number: 20230147408Abstract: The present disclosure discloses a system and method for dynamically modifying role based access control for a client based on the activity. Generally, a client device is granted access to a network resource based on a first reputation score assigned to the client device. The activity of the client device is monitored. Responsive to monitoring the activity of the client device, a second reputation score is determined for the client device based on the activity. The access by the client device to the network resource is then modified to be granted based on the second reputation score.Type: ApplicationFiled: January 9, 2023Publication date: May 11, 2023Inventors: Ramesh ARDELI, Hari Krishna KURMALA

Patent number: 10992702Abstract: In example implementations, a method is provided that is executed by a processor. A multiplexed data stream is received over a single transmission control protocol (TCP) connection that uses a SPDY protocol. The multiplexed data stream contains data packets associated with a plurality of different data streams. A plurality of sub-contexts are generated. Each one of the sub-contexts is associated with a different one of the plurality of different data streams. The data packets are demultiplexed from the multiplexed data stream into a respective one of the plurality of sub-contexts. The plurality of different data streams in the respective one of the plurality of sub-contexts are examined to detect a malware.Type: GrantFiled: January 27, 2016Date of Patent: April 27, 2021Assignee: Hewlett Packard Enterprise Development LPInventors: Ramesh Ardeli, Hari Krishna Kurmala

Patent number: 10993169Abstract: Methods and systems are described for intelligently steering client devices operating in an enterprise network system to an appropriate access point based on types of traffic on each client device and/or types of traffic on access points. In particular, client devices may be moved to a different access point when the wireless channel provided by a current access point fails to meet the signal strength requirements of latency sensitive traffic utilized by the client device. Client devices may be further steered to new access points based on load conditions on access points. For example, client devices with low priority traffic sessions may be steered away from access points with high traffic load levels. Accordingly, the methods and systems described herein ensure improved network access for latency sensitive access categories and/or access categories that are considered important to an enterprise system with minimal disruptions to these sessions.Type: GrantFiled: December 4, 2017Date of Patent: April 27, 2021Assignee: Hewlett Packard Enterprise Development LPInventors: Ramesh Ardeli, Hari Krishna Kurmala, Vamsi Kodavanty

Patent number: 10984103Abstract: An example implementation of the present techniques determines, in response to a request to download a resource, whether the resource has previously been determined to comprise malware. Additionally, it is determined, if the resource has previously been determined to comprise malware, whether the resource has changed since the previous determination. Further the request to download the resource is terminated if the resource has not changed.Type: GrantFiled: January 26, 2016Date of Patent: April 20, 2021Assignee: Hewlett Packard Enterprise Development LPInventor: Ramesh Ardeli

Patent number: 10771391Abstract: Examples disclosed herein relate to enforcing a policy to a packet stream based on a classification and a determination that a proxy connection is associated with the packet stream. In the example, the packet stream is received. In this example, a host value is determined for the packet stream. Also, in the example, it is determined whether the packet stream is associated with the proxy connection. Further, in the example, a classification is determined based on the host value. In this example, the policy is enforced for the packet stream based on the classification and the determination that the proxy connection is associated with the packet stream.Type: GrantFiled: November 5, 2015Date of Patent: September 8, 2020Assignee: Hewlett Packard Enterprise Development LPInventors: Ramesh Ardeli, Venkatesan Marichetty, Hari Krishna Kurmala

Patent number: 9998947Abstract: The present disclosure discloses a method and network device for intelligent handling of voice calls from mobile voice client devices. In some embodiments, the network device detects that a load, corresponding to a plurality of client devices associated with an access point, exceeds a particular threshold value. In some embodiments, the network device detects that a call quality for a current ongoing call, corresponding to a first client device associated with an access point, is below a first threshold value. In response, the network device selects a particular client device, of the plurality of client devices associated with the access point, for disassociation with the access point. The network device then causes the particular client device to disassociate with the access point.Type: GrantFiled: September 16, 2016Date of Patent: June 12, 2018Assignee: ARUBA NETWORKS, INC.Inventors: Gopal Agarwal, Ramesh Ardeli, Venkatesh Joshi, Vamsi Kodavanty, Hari Kurmala, Edward Vajravelu
